The Cabinet on Tuesday approved the adjustments to all 9 coins in circulation, expecting to save the minting cost by Bt1.9 billion per annum.
Chodechai Suwanaporn, deputy government spokesman, said after the Cabinet meeting that the resolution will affect new coins.
"The changes follow the minting cost which is higher than the nominal value. The changes will cut cost by Bt1.9 billion per year," he said. ...
